Choosing materials with longevity and circularity in mind

Material decisions are where the product promise is made. For keepsakes, prioritize:

  • Modular components: design elements that can be swapped or replaced by the owner.
  • Monomaterial assemblies: simplify recycling pipelines by using single polymer families or natural fibers.
  • Repair kits: include small, low‑cost kits (thread, glue, adhesive patches) to enable home repairs.

Micro‑fulfilment and pop‑up logistics

Fast local fulfilment reduces carbon footprint and accelerates delivery times — critical for keepsakes bought on impulse. The field report on Micro‑Fulfilment & Pop‑Up Logistics explains cloud orchestration and hybrid edge patterns you can adopt to run a weekend market stall while also serving nearby online buyers within 24 hours.

Key patterns include:

  • Distributed staging: a network of small lockers or partner venues to hold ready‑to‑ship parcels.
  • Flexible pick routes: same‑day couriers from your pop‑up location during event hours.
  • Embedded payments: POS that captures repair intents and upsells repair kits at checkout.

Inventory tools and predictive sheets

Predicting limited‑edition demand is a skill. For low‑margin keepsakes, using simple predictive inventory sheets can prevent expensive overproduction. The Advanced Inventory: Predictive Google Sheets for Limited‑Edition Drops guide offers a plug‑and‑play sheet and formulas that help you model scarcity, lead times, and reorder points for small batches.

Practical tips:

  • Model three scenarios: conservative, expected, and viral. Keep safety stock only for core SKUs.
  • Use event‑level multipliers for pop‑ups (weekday vs. weekend vs. festival).
  • Track token consumption separately from product stock; tokens (stickers, cards) often deplete faster.

Case study: a weekend maker who cut returns by 40%

One maker we advised implemented a modular keepsake with a replaceable leather loop and an included repair kit. They also shifted fulfilment to a local locker network and used a predictive sheet for limited runs. Results in 90 days:

  • Returns dropped 40% due to clear repair instructions.
  • Local same‑day orders rose 27% after listing with local pickup options.
  • Packaging costs rose 6% but average order value increased 14% from repair kit upsells.

Step‑by‑step starter checklist

  1. Audit materials and identify 2 immediate swaps toward mono‑materials.
  2. Create a $0.50 repair kit that fits inside your standard parcel.
  3. Set up a basic predictive inventory sheet from the linked template.
  4. Test local fulfilment for one SKU at a weekend pop‑up and measure turnaround.
  5. Publish repair instructions and a visible repair policy on product pages.
